
制作出入库统计软件的步骤可以归纳为以下几个主要方面:1、确定需求和目标,2、选择合适的平台和工具,3、设计数据库结构,4、开发核心功能模块,5、测试与优化,6、部署与维护。其中,确定需求和目标是最关键的一步,因为只有明确了需求,才能确保软件开发的方向和功能符合实际使用要求。
一、确定需求和目标
-
明确业务需求:
- 了解企业的仓库管理流程,包括商品的入库、出库、库存盘点等环节。
- 确定需要统计的数据类型,如商品名称、数量、供应商信息、出库客户信息等。
- 确认统计报表的格式和展示方式,如日报、周报、月报等。
-
定义用户角色和权限:
- 确定软件的使用者和他们的权限,如管理员、仓库人员、财务人员等。
- 确保不同角色能够访问和操作相应的数据,保护敏感信息。
-
确定系统目标:
- 提高仓库管理效率,减少人工统计的错误。
- 实现实时库存查询和预警功能,防止库存短缺或积压。
- 生成详尽的统计报表,辅助决策。
二、选择合适的平台和工具
-
开发语言和框架:
- 可以选择Java、Python、C#等编程语言。
- 使用Spring、Django、.NET等框架提升开发效率。
-
数据库管理系统:
- 选择适合的数据库,如MySQL、PostgreSQL、MongoDB等。
- 确保数据库能够高效处理大规模数据,并支持事务处理。
-
前端技术:
- 使用HTML、CSS、JavaScript等技术进行前端开发。
- 选择React、Vue.js、Angular等前端框架,提升用户体验。
-
第三方工具和服务:
- 引入报表生成工具,如JasperReports、Crystal Reports等。
- 使用云服务平台,如AWS、Azure、阿里云等,提升系统的扩展性和可靠性。
三、设计数据库结构
-
设计数据表:
- 商品信息表:包含商品ID、名称、规格、单位等。
- 入库记录表:记录每次入库的商品ID、数量、供应商、入库时间等。
- 出库记录表:记录每次出库的商品ID、数量、客户、出库时间等。
- 库存表:实时记录各商品的库存数量。
-
建立表关系:
- 商品信息表与入库记录表、出库记录表通过商品ID进行关联。
- 入库记录表和出库记录表与库存表通过商品ID进行关联。
-
优化数据库性能:
- 添加索引以提升查询效率。
- 设计触发器或存储过程,确保数据一致性和完整性。
四、开发核心功能模块
-
入库管理模块:
- 实现商品入库操作,记录入库信息。
- 更新库存表中的库存数量。
-
出库管理模块:
- 实现商品出库操作,记录出库信息。
- 更新库存表中的库存数量。
-
库存查询模块:
- 提供实时库存查询功能。
- 显示库存预警信息,防止库存短缺或积压。
-
统计报表模块:
- 生成各类统计报表,如日报、周报、月报等。
- 支持报表导出功能,如导出为Excel、PDF等格式。
五、测试与优化
-
功能测试:
- 逐个测试各功能模块,确保其能够正常运行。
- 测试边界情况和异常情况,确保系统的健壮性。
-
性能测试:
- 模拟大规模数据操作,测试系统的响应速度。
- 优化数据库查询,提升系统性能。
-
用户测试:
- 让实际用户试用系统,收集反馈意见。
- 根据用户反馈进行改进,提升用户体验。
六、部署与维护
-
系统部署:
- 将系统部署到服务器上,确保其能够稳定运行。
- 配置备份机制,防止数据丢失。
-
系统维护:
- 定期检查系统运行状态,及时修复问题。
- 根据业务需求变化,进行系统升级和功能扩展。
-
用户培训:
- 对使用者进行培训,确保他们能够正确使用系统。
- 提供使用手册和技术支持,帮助用户解决问题。
总结来说,制作出入库统计软件需要经过明确需求、选择工具、设计数据库、开发功能、测试优化和部署维护等六大步骤。每一步都需要精心规划和执行,以确保软件的实用性和稳定性。希望通过本文的详细介绍,您能够更好地理解和应用这些步骤,成功制作出符合需求的出入库统计软件。若有需要,可以参考简道云WMS仓库管理系统模板: https://s.fanruan.com/q6mjx;,获取更多实用的工具和资源。
相关问答FAQs:
出入库统计软件怎么制作?
制作出入库统计软件的过程涉及多个步骤,包括需求分析、系统设计、功能实现以及测试与部署等。首先,在需求分析阶段,需要明确软件的目标用户、主要功能和使用场景。常见的功能包括库存管理、出入库记录、报表生成等。系统设计阶段则需要规划软件的架构,包括前端和后端的选择、数据库设计以及用户界面的设计。功能实现阶段是编码的过程,需要选择合适的开发语言和工具。测试与部署阶段确保软件的稳定性和可靠性,并将其上线供用户使用。整个制作过程需要团队协作,确保软件符合用户的需求和行业标准。
制作出入库统计软件时需要考虑哪些关键因素?
在制作出入库统计软件时,有几个关键因素需要重点关注。首先,用户体验是非常重要的,软件的界面应该简洁明了,操作流程应尽量简单,让用户能够快速上手。其次,数据安全性不可忽视,库存数据是企业的重要资产,必须采取措施保护数据不被泄露或丢失。第三,系统的稳定性和性能也很关键,软件需要能够处理大量的数据和并发用户,保证在高负载情况下仍能正常运行。此外,软件的扩展性也需要考虑,随着企业的发展,可能需要增加新的功能或模块,软件架构应具备良好的扩展性。
出入库统计软件的功能有哪些?
出入库统计软件的功能可以根据企业的需求进行定制,以下是一些常见的功能模块:
- 库存管理:实时监控库存状态,自动更新库存数量,支持多仓库管理,方便企业掌握库存情况。
- 出入库记录:记录每一笔出入库操作,包括操作时间、操作人员、货物信息等,确保操作的可追溯性。
- 报表生成:根据库存数据和出入库记录自动生成各类报表,如库存报表、出入库报表、月度统计报表等,帮助管理层做出决策。
- 预警机制:设置库存预警,当库存低于设定值时及时提醒相关人员,避免缺货或过期等情况发生。
- 权限管理:根据不同角色设置不同的操作权限,确保数据的安全性和操作的合规性。
- 数据导入导出:支持Excel等格式的数据导入导出,方便用户进行数据的批量处理。
通过结合这些功能,出入库统计软件能够有效提升企业的管理效率,降低人为错误,帮助企业做出更为科学的决策。
阅读时间:9 分钟
浏览量:263次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








